W-A022625-01 New Hill County and nearby 345-kV (SAMSW) Generic Transmission Constraint (GTC)


NOTICE DATE: February 26, 2025

NOTICE TYPE: W-A022625-01 Operations

SHORT DESCRIPTION: New Hill County and nearby 345-kV (SAMSW) Generic Transmission Constraint (GTC)

INTENDED AUDIENCE: ERCOT Market Participants

DAYS AFFECTED: March 05, 2025

LONG DESCRIPTION: Results from the Sub-Synchronous Resonance (SSR) study for a planned Generation Resource included in the Quarterly Stability Assessment (QSA) in Q3 2024 indicated stability issues related to large power export out of the 345-kV transmission system in the Hill County and nearby area under prior outage conditions.  Following the SSR study, which identified potential instability issues, a GTC assessment was conducted to assess the impact of the planned Generation Resources. The evaluation concluded that a GTC is necessary to manage the stability of the 345-kV transmission system in the Hill County and nearby area. As a result, SAMSW GTC has been created in the ERCOT Network Operations Model.

The purpose of this Notice is to provide contemporaneous notification to all ERCOT Market Participants of these updates. ERCOT will begin enforcing the new Hill County and nearby 345-kV Area GTC Generic Limits on March 05, 2025.

Details associated with all GTCs (EMIL ID NP3-770-M, Report ID 11425) can be found on the ERCOT Market Information System (MIS) Grid Transmission page under the Generic Transmission Constraints Methodology Secured Area. A Digital Certificate with role ICE_M_VIEW_ECEII is required to access this ECEII data.
